Brand Origin and Market Position
Nature Made started with a commitment to providing science-backed nutrition at accessible price points. This positioning helped the brand quickly occupy shelf space in mass merchants and drugstores.
Its clear label claims and recognizable packaging reinforce trust, which translates into repeat purchases and sustained revenue. Strong market presence forms a core pillar of the net worth narrative.
Product Quality and Third-Party Testing
Quality assurance plays a major role in protecting the brand value and net worth. Nature Made follows cGMP practices and submits many products to independent verification.
Consumers associate these rigorous checks with safety, making them more willing to try new products and recommend them to others. This cycle of trust boosts lifetime customer value.

Comparison with Competing Brands
Nature Made differentiates through wide availability, transparent labeling, and consistent potency testing. Some premium brands focus on boutique sourcing, while budget options may lack third-party verification.
Consumers often choose Nature Made as a middle-ground option that balances cost, trust, and efficacy. This balanced profile supports reliable revenue and strengthens overall net worth.
